Therapeutic
Touch With Crystals: Therapeutic
touch was developed by Dee Kreiger. She has spread it throughout the nursing
community all over the world. It is a no contact therapy usually with the person
seated. A clear quartz crystal is used to inhance the energy work...A chance to
try it will be provided... Taught by OhShinnah and Dee Kreiger in 1985...they
are close friends and now roommates.

Friday Children's Sweat: 4PM~ Bear Heart Friday Night 8PM: Women's Sweat Lodge~ Shawna Mitchell, Men's Sweat Lodge~ Mike Andrews Saturday Sunrise Coed Sweat: The Conch Shell will signal the time to gather around 4:30am~Enrique Hynes Dress for the sweat lodge consists of shorts, swim trunks, or sarong for the men and T'shirt 'n shorts, swimsuit, dress, or sarong for the women. Please bring a towel to sit on. Women on their Moon time will be allowed to participate in the Women's Lodge, Sunrise Coed Lodge, and Saturday Night Coed Lodge. Please be well hydrated if you are planning to attending any of the lodges and encourage your children to drink water throughout the day if they are attending the Children's Lodge with BearHeart. An altar is available outside the Lodge for placement of any items you may wish to be empowered by this sacred and healing ceremony.
